3D-printed polycaprolactone scaffolds coated with beta tricalcium phosphate for bone regeneration
Background/Purpose: 3D-printing technology is an important tool for the bone tissue engineering (BTE). The aim of this study was to investigate the interaction of polycaprolactone (PCL) scaffolds and modified mesh PCL coated with beta TCP (PCL/β-TCP) scaffolds with MG-63.
